Emergency LGBTI shelter

for refugees before the asylum decision

What's this about?

You can get support here if you are gay, bisexual, trans or intersex. And if you don't feel safe in your accommodation. Or if you have experienced violence or discrimination there. There is an emergency shelter for LGBTI refugees here. A staff member will tell you what papers you need. And they'll tell you what you need to do.
